QUALITY RESIDENT LIAISON

Quality Resident Liaison Essential Functions/Duties:

  • It is the responsibility of the Quality Resident Liaison to act as the main quality interface between the Customer and OPmobility for our Just-In-Time production environment. 

  • Provide support needed to address Customer quality issues and Customer trials.

  • Act as the Customer voice to OPmobility regarding quality issues.

  • Define Customer requirements communicate with the plant and to develop benchmarking activities that will support us in exceeding the Customer’s expectations.

  • Support Product launches.

  • Ensuring compliance to and participation in IATF 16949 and CSR (Customer Specific Requirements) compliance & ISO 14001 certification.

  • Develop and maintain Customer Liaison activities with Tesla personnel and corporate staff.

  • Maintain positive relations.

  • Prepare daily / weekly concern and non-conformance reports.

  • Assist the quality department in 8D activity.

  • Coordinate clean point activity.

  • Monitor and Control Change Management and CN’s.

  • Perform LPAs as assigned.

  • Assist LO Department when needed (expedites).

  • End of shift report/electronic distribution.

  • Maintain an open issue list.

  • Perform hourly audit in sequence loads at installation.

  • Talk to assembly plant personnel at least 3x’s per shift.

  • Environmental Management.

  • Has the ability to stop production, upon notifying the Supervisor and Plant Manager for Safety related matters requiring immediate attention.

  • Has the ability to stop production, upon notifying the Supervisor and Plant Manager for quality-related nonconforming matters requiring immediate repair.

  • Support Maintaining of ISO 45001 and ISO 50001 processes.

  • Other duties as assigned.
     

 

Education/Professional Training:

  • Highschool Diploma
  • 3+ years working experience in a Quality, Technical or Liaison experience in a manufacturing enviroment- Tier 1 preferred
  • Negotiation skills
